What is 30/445 as a percentage?

30/445 = ≈6.74%

Rounded to 2 decimal places.

How to work it out

  1. Divide the top by the bottom: 30 ÷ 445 = 0.0674 (rounded)
  2. Multiply by 100: 0.0674 × 100 = 6.74%

A fraction like 30/445 can describe a small share of a larger group, such as 30 students out of 445, 30 successful deliveries out of 445, or 30 defective items in a shipment of 445. In each case, the portion is 6.74%, so it represents a noticeable but relatively small part of the whole.

To picture it quickly, imagine 100 equal spots with about 7 of them marked. You can also think of 30 out of 445 as roughly 1 out of every 15 people or items, which makes the size easier to estimate.

A common mistake is to look at the numerator, 30, and assume the fraction means 30%, but the denominator shows that the 30 items are being compared with a much larger total of 445. The fraction only describes the share within that specific group, so the same number 30 could represent a very different percentage when the total changes.
